      Exploring the Universe - an overview of the future directions of ESA's space science programme, made for the 25th anniversary of the Agency. Topics are explained in detail, The documentary covers stellar science; investigating the Sun, including solar oscillations; the structure of comets (Giotto and Halley's comet); and the then upcoming missions Cornerstone missions: SOHO, Cluster, Cassini-Huygens, Rosetta, XMM-Newton, Herschel (then called FIRST). It includes animations, real astronomical images and interviews with eminent scientists on the value of the missions and the strengths of European space science, including Douglas Gogh, Catherine Cesarsky (French with English subtitles, Johann Bleeker (German with English subtitles)
